SPAIN vs ITALY.... ANOTHER CLASSIC
Sunday afternoon brought forth another classic matchup for hardcore soccer fans as
SPAIN faced off against
ITALY to determine the fourth and final Semi-Finalist for
EURO 2008. Up to this point, aside from
Germany, all of the quarterfinal favorites fell by the wayside. So there was a lot of pressure on the Spaniards to win their match as they were the favorites against the old, but pesky
Italy team. History wasn't on Spain's side either, as the past revealed that the last four times that the Spaniards played a meaningful match (i.e. World Cup or European Cup) on June 22th, they lost each time.

In any case, we were treated to yet another fascinating match as
Spain and
Italy went back and forth and ended up going to penalty kicks before
Spain was able to pull out a hard-fought victory, 4-2 (p.k's).
